How to measure your wrist size
Wrap a garment measuring tape snuggly around your wrist just below the wrist bone. Alternatively use a piece of string and then measure the string length with a ruler. The average wrist size for men is 6.5-7.5", and for women is 5.5-6.5".
How to choose the right case size
Case diameter determines the watch size: it’s the width of the watch case, excluding the crown. Small wrists (<6") suit 28–36mm, average (6–7") fit 36–42mm, and larger wrists (7"+) can wear 42mm+. Smaller cases can feel refined or vintage-inspired, while larger ones make a bold, modern statement.

From the ’70s to the Stars
We're paying homage to the 1972 Apollo 17 mission to the moon with a cosmic reimagining of our '70s Q Timex. Full of stellar details, this watch includes a multifunction movement with sub-dials tracking the day of the week, the date, and a day/night indicator depicting sun and moon illustrations. Full of stellar details, this watch includes a multifunction movement with sub-dials tracking the day of the week, the date, and a day/night indicator depicting sun and moon illustrations. The most captivating detail: a luminous moon graphic in the day of the week sub-dial, glowing with the same in-fill as the hands and markers so that it shines like the moon itself. Turning the watch over reveals another tribute to space history with the iconic “Blue Marble” photograph, captured by Apollo 17 astronauts on their journey home. Completing the look is a fully brushed bracelet crafted of stainless steel and an ornamental tachymeter bezel.

Acrylic Crystal
Highly impact-resistant
Acrylic lens are a specialised form of plastic akin to Plexiglass and were commonly used in early to mid-20th century watches. It is a softer material that can be more prone to scratches but conversely is very shatter-resistant. Given its softness any scratches though can be buffed out. Acrylic lens are synonymous with vintage-inspired timepieces and thus can be found on our Marlin and Q Timex collections.

This bracelet style is new to me. How do I adjust it? Are there instructions or a video to watch anywhere?
Hi db! To adjust the strap on your watch, follow these steps: FOLDOVER CLASP BRACELET 1. Find spring bar that connects bracelet to clasp 2. Using a pointed tool, push in spring bar and gently twist bracelet to disengage 3. Determine wrist size, then insert spring bar in correct bottom hole 4. Push down on spring bar, align with top hole and release to lock in place BRACELET LINK REMOVAL REMOVING LINKS: 1. Place bracelet upright and insert pointed tool in opening of link. 2. Push pin forcefully in direction of arrow until link is detached (pins are designed to be difficult to remove). 3. Repeat until desired number of links are removed. RE-ASSEMBLY: 1. Rejoin bracelet parts. 2. Push pin back into link in opposite direction of arrow. 3. Press pin down securely into bracelet until it is flush. If you need assistance or prefer professional adjustment, we recommend visiting a local jeweler. Let me know if there’s anything else I can assist you with!
